Title Rabbula Gospels (Gospel Book): Canon Table II: Jonas and the city of Nineveh and Micah with the healing of the crippled woman and Samaritan at the well
Creator Rabbula (scribe)
Building St. John of Zagba Monastery (origin)
Style Period Early Christian Art; Byzantine Art
Description The text is the Peshitta version of the Syriac translation of the Gospels
Subject Religious Art; Illuminated Manuscripts
Creation Date ca. 586 CE
Form illuminated manuscript
Medium tempera on vellum
Dimensions 336 x 266 mm
Repository Biblioteca Mediceo Laurenziana, cod. Plut. I, 56, folio 6r; Florence (Italy)
Source Il Tetravangelo di Rabbula. ed. Massimo Bernabo, Rome, 2008.
